Minnesota Code § 629.401

DELAYING TO TAKE PRISONER BEFORE JUDGE.
Open in Lexace · Ask the AI about this section
A peace officer or other person who willfully and wrongfully delays taking an arrested person before a judge having appropriate criminal jurisdiction is guilty of a gross misdemeanor.
